Responsibilities
- Develop and execute the enterprise Digital Workspace strategy, aligned with organizational goals and modern workplace trends.
- Develop and own the long-term roadmap for the ServiceNow platform.
- Serve as the primary point of contact for all ServiceNow platform initiatives and governance.
- Establish best practices, standards, and scalable architectural design.
- Lead the design, development, and implementation of ServiceNow modules ITSM, ITAM, HAM & SAM
- Manage demand intake, prioritize backlogs, and ensure timely delivery of enhancements and projects.
- Partner with stakeholders across IT, HR, Security, SAP, and Operations to identify automation and workflow improvement opportunities.
- Architect integrations between ServiceNow and third-party systems (such as Microsoft Entra, Intune, Workday, SAP, Snowflake and custom APIs), ensuring seamless data flow and system interoperability.
- Provide directions to team managing and maintaining the Configuration Management Database (CMDB), ensuring data accuracy and integrity through discovery tools and service mapping.
- Establish governance policies, integrating the CMDB with IT Service Management (ITSM) processes like Incident and Change Management, and providing technical leadership and support to align IT services with business strategies.
- Partner with Information Security and Compliance teams to conduct periodic platform audits, risk assessments, and vulnerability remediations.
- Use analytics and customer feedback to drive improvements in end user experience and service reliability.
- Champion user-centric design principles and ensure services meet accessibility, usability, and performance standards.
- Implement robust change management, version control, and release management processes.
- Drive automation and self-service capabilities to reduce friction in daily user workflows.
- Manage the relationship with ServiceNow and partner with MSP to drive licensing optimization and cost management.
- Evaluate emerging technologies and recommend solutions that enhance employee productivity.
- The position will exercise full autonomy and identify opportunities to automate workflows and improve platform efficiency without waiting for direction. The position will identify opportunities to automate workflows and improve existing workflows.
- Serve as a subject-matter expert (SME), advising teams on best practices and platform capabilities, engage directly with senior business stakeholders, and guide development teams through delivery while ensuring compliance with governance and architectural standards.

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in information technology, Computer Science, Business Administration, or related field required.
- ServiceNow certifications (e.g., Certified System Administrator, Certified Application Developer, CIS-ITSM, CIS-ITOM or GRC).
- ITIL v4 certification or similar service management credentials.

Legend Biotech is a global biotechnology company dedicated to treating, and one day curing, life-threatening diseases. Headquartered in Somerset, New Jersey, we are developing advanced cell therapies across a diverse array of technology platforms, including autologous and allogenic chimeric antigen receptor T-cell, T-cell receptor (TCR-T), and natural killer (NK) cell-based immunotherapy. From our three R&D sites around the world, we apply these innovative technologies to pursue the discovery of safe, efficacious and cutting-edge therapeutics for patients worldwide. Legend Biotech entered into a global collaboration agreement with Janssen, one of the pharmaceutical companies of Johnson & Johnson, to jointly develop and commercialize ciltacabtagene autolecuel (cilta-cel). Our strategic partnership is designed to combine the strengths and expertise of both companies to advance the promise of an immunotherapy in the treatment of multiple myeloma. Legend Biotech is seeking a Sr. Manager Digital Workplace as part of the Information Technology team based in Bridgewater, NJ. Role Overview The Senior Manager, Digital Workspace leads the strategy, design, implementation, and continuous improvement of digital workplace technologies that enable a seamless, secure, and productive employee experience. This role oversees workplace automation, Service Now platform and develop business catalogs to deliver scalable, secure, and high-quality ServiceNow solutions that enable employee engagement, streamline IT and business processes thereby enhancing employee experience.
